Evaluation of H.264/AVC error resilience in HD IPTV applications

The delivery of High Definition Television (HDTV) over IP networks, namely the HD IPTV, has emerged as one of the major distribution and access techniques for broadband multimedia services. IPTV adopts H.264/AVC as its coding standard due to its high video compression efficiency as well as powerful error resilience features. This paper presents studies on some of these features applied to HD IPTV applications. A test system is deployed to simulate the delivery of HD video over a DSL based IPTV network. Effects of error resilience of slicing and Instantaneous Decoding Refreshing (IDR) features on video quality are examined in both channel non-impaired and channel impaired with burst noise circumstances. Based on the acquired results, optimal slice size was obtained for HD video transmission over an impaired channel. The quality of experience related to the IDR interval in combating error propagation was also characterized.
